    Germany – Authorities Stopping Public Funding to Berlin’s Shul

    By admin on September 3, 2010

    Berlin, Germany – German authorities have stopped the flow of public funds to the country’s only independent Jewish congregation, reportedly due to the failure to submit audited accounts covering 2001-2006.
    Adass Yisroel, a traditional congregation in Berlin, is also facing a demand by the Berlin Senate that it repay about 204,000 euros in state subsidies.
